Output 5951145601c4a5c78ed523bded8d2fa74e38a546e4472c8d524f2612904bb73c:1

value
800000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a473499b3bd4d3182ee9a30ce0afa91c34fa4213 OP_EQUALVERIFY OP_CHECKSIG
address
1FzXvn7h6W2drtRzqnhGKb9A7jeNhGfqhe
transaction
5951145601c4a5c78ed523bded8d2fa74e38a546e4472c8d524f2612904bb73c
confirmations
112149
spent
true